• DocumentCode
    2132025
  • Title

    Object migration in non-monolithic distributed applications

  • Author

    Ciupke, Oliver ; Kottmann, Dietmar A. ; Walter, Hans-Dirk

  • Author_Institution
    Forschungszentrum Inf., Karlsruhe, Germany
  • fYear
    1996
  • fDate
    27-30 May 1996
  • Firstpage
    529
  • Lastpage
    536
  • Abstract
    Object migration is usually applied to optimize distributed monolithic systems. We investigate the effects of using object migration in cooperative systems which consist of autonomous, independently developed components. We show that the use of migration policies which are set up with only one component in mind can have detrimental effects on the overall performance. To avoid this without changing the internal structure of the components, we introduce two novel approaches: transient placement and reduction of attachment-transitiveness. The effects of these modifications are evaluated by simulation
  • Keywords
    cooperative systems; data encapsulation; distributed processing; object-oriented programming; attachment-transitiveness; autonomous independently developed components; cooperative systems; migration policies; nonmonolithic distributed applications; object migration; transient placement; Counting circuits; Degradation; Fault tolerance; Manufacturing automation; Object oriented modeling; Runtime;
  • fLanguage
    English
  • Publisher
    ieee
  • Conference_Titel
    Distributed Computing Systems, 1996., Proceedings of the 16th International Conference on
  • Print_ISBN
    0-8186-7399-0
  • Type

    conf

  • DOI
    10.1109/ICDCS.1996.508002
  • Filename
    508002